Class 50s in 50 minutes! A comprehensive lineside record of the ‘Hoovers’
at work on the BR main line during the 5-year period 1987-1991. Moving
through the years, the programme vividly illustrates the many changes
that took place to the operational territories and the duties of the
class, and contains a superb variety of workings...
• Paddington-Oxford & Newbury services
• Chiltern Line workings
• West Country passenger duties
• Waterloo-Exeter services
• Inter City passenger turns
• DCWA Civil Engineers traffic
• West Country freight
• Railtours, Newspapers & Parcels
Many notable workings are included - the last booked Thames &
Chiltern double-headers, the last booked 50 over the Chiltern route,
Southampton diversions, 50046 on Bardon aggregates, 50002 on
Freightliners, 50007 on the Windsor & Eton branch, 50149 on china clay duties and 50032
& 50026 at King’s Cross.
The programme also features 1991 celebrity repaint locos Valiant,
Thunderer, Hood and D400 in action. The demise of the class is also
captured in some remarkable scenes filmed at Old Oak Common as
Collingwood and Courageous are dragged onto the depot’s famous
turntable and put to the cutter’s torch. Undignified, but sadly all
part of the story.
